GAA NEWS: MILFORD GAA CLUB NOTES

written by Stephen Maguire January 8, 2013
FacebookTweetLinkedInPrint

*Jigs and Reels*

Milford GAA in association with Milford National School will present Jigs and Reels in the Silver Tassie Hotel on February 15th, 2013. A fantastic nights fun and laughter guaranteed!! Only 15 Euro for an Adult and 5 Euro for children. Support the club and the national school and get your ticket from any committee member, the Milford Post Office or from any of the participants.

 

*Senior/Reserve Presentation Night*

The Senior and Reserves mens teams held their presentation night in Dustys Bar, Milford on the 28th of December. Congratulations to all the winners on the night:

Senior Player of the Year: Pauric Curley

Young Players of the Year: Cathal McGettigan

U21 Player of the Year: TJ Evesson

Reserve Player of the Year: Seamus O Donnell

Most Improved Player of the Year: Glen McElhinney

Clubman of the Year: Jim Gormally

*Azzurri Sports Quiz*

The club recently came second in a Facebook competition run by Azzurri Sports. In a ‘Know your Sport’ quiz the club came second in a field of over 100 competitors to win an Azzurri Sports voucher worth €500 for the club. A massive thanks to everyone who did the quiz, and especially to those who went above and beyond by getting their colleagues, relatives, and friends who have no affiliation with the club to do it.

*Conversational Irish Classes*

Conversational Irish classes will resume on the 16th of January and continue every Wednesday at 7pm in the clubhouse at Moyleview Park. Adults and children welcome. Admission: Adults €2, Children €1. The classes will be for 1.5 hours and refreshments will be provided.
